A study
of bat deaths at a local wind farm by the University of Calgary reported by Science Daily found that the majority of migratory bats in this location were killed because a sudden drop in air pressure near the blades caused injuries to the bats» lungs known as barotrauma.
North American studies
of bat deaths and wind turbines have found bats are killed either by being struck by turbine blades or by air pressure changes caused by the turbines that burst blood vessels in their lungs.

The majority
of human rabies
deaths in the last 20 years in the United States have been caused by the rabies virus
of bats.

In addition to White Nose Syndrome,
deaths connected to collisions with wind turbines are now the leading cause
of multiple mortality events in
bats (O'Shea et al., 2016).
